Meinl Sonic Energy Bendo Shaker Large
The Meinl Sonic Energy Bendo Shaker is a hand percussion instrument constructed from natural bendo seed nutshells attached to a wrist strap. Designed for clear, crisp sonic textures, it allows performers to integrate percussive accents into musical sessions without occupying their hands.

The Meinl Sonic Energy Bendo Shaker (Large) is a specialised percussion instrument belonging to the Sonic Energy collection. It utilizes organic materials—specifically bendo seed nutshells—to create a distinct acoustic profile. Unlike traditional handheld shakers, this model is designed to be worn, facilitating rhythmic accompaniment while the musician plays other instruments.
Design and Functionality
The instrument consists of several dried bendo nutshells grouped together and fastened to a durable wrist strap. This design serves two primary purposes: ease of transport and accessibility during performance. By securing the shaker to the wrist, the user can generate sound through natural arm movements or by striking the shells against another surface, leaving the hands free to interact with keyboards, guitars, or other percussion.
Sound Character
The sonic profile of the Bendo Shaker is defined as clear and crisp. The density of the bendo nutshells provides a sharper attack compared to soft-fill shakers. When the shells collide, they produce a bright, organic rattling effect that sits well in acoustic mixes and ambient soundscapes. The 'Large' designation indicates a greater volume of shells, providing a fuller texture than smaller variants.
Applications and Target Audience
This shaker is particularly suited for:
- Multi-instrumentalists: Those needing percussive layers while playing primary instruments.
- Sound Therapists: The 'Sonic Energy' line is frequently used in meditative and wellness contexts due to the natural timbre of the materials.
- Studio Percussionists: Adding organic grit and intrigue to recorded tracks.
- Live Performers: Providing a visual and auditory element that is easily toggled on and off by changing movement styles.

Frequently asked questions
- What material is the Meinl Sonic Energy Bendo Shaker made from?
- The shaker is constructed using natural bendo seed nutshells. These shells are dried and attached to a wrist strap to produce sound through collision.
- How is the shaker worn during a performance?
- It features a convenient wrist strap that allows the user to secure the instrument to their arm. This design keeps the shaker accessible while leaving the hands free for other tasks.
- What kind of sound does the Bendo Shaker produce?
- The sound is described as clear and crisp. It provides an organic rattling texture that is distinct from synthetic or metallic percussion instruments.
- Is the Bendo Shaker suitable for sound healing?
- Yes, as part of the Meinl Sonic Energy series, it is designed for musical sessions that often include meditation and sound therapy. Its natural timbre is well-suited for these environments.
- How does the 'Large' version differ from smaller shakers?
- The Large version typically features a greater number of shells or larger shells, resulting in a fuller, more prominent sound compared to smaller models. This makes it more effective in larger ensembles.
- Can I use this shaker while playing the guitar?
- Yes, the wrist strap design is specifically intended for multi-instrumentalists. It allows guitarists to add rhythmic accents through their strumming arm movements.
- Is the Meinl Bendo Shaker waterproof?
- No, because it is made from natural seed nutshells, it should be kept dry. Moisture can affect the integrity of the organic materials and the quality of the sound.
- How does it compare to the Meinl Spin Spark Shaker?
- The Bendo Shaker produces an earthy, natural sound from nutshells, whereas the Spin Spark Shaker typically offers a more industrial, metallic tone. The Bendo Shaker is also wrist-mounted, unlike many handheld shakers.

- Does this shaker require any maintenance?
- General maintenance involves keeping the nutshells clean and dry. It is recommended to store it in a temperature-controlled environment to prevent the natural shells from cracking.

- Is this instrument loud enough for an unamplified live band?
- The Bendo Shaker provides a clear and crisp sound that cuts through acoustic settings well. However, in high-volume electric settings, it may require a microphone to be heard clearly.
